Moorpark College

Region: South Central Coast

At a glance

Moorpark College has developed a mature, faculty-led AI adoption framework anchored by librarian Danielle Kaprelian and instructional technologist Trudi Radtke, who maintain a comprehensive AI Toolkit LibGuide (3+ years of research) and offer an AI Faculty Academy available for institutional adoption. The college has embedded AI explicitly in its academic dishonesty policy, provides syllabus statement guidance ranging from restrictive to permissive, and runs regular professional development sessions on AI basics, classroom applications, and academic honesty.

AI-Engaged People, Processes & Timelines · 4
  • 🆕AI Faculty Academy offered for institutional adoption. The AI Toolkit Administrators page describes an 'AI Faculty Academy' led by Danielle Kaprelian and Trudi Radtke that is available for institutional adoption, alongside an 'AI Literacy Gameplan for Administrators' infographic created by Radtke. 2026 · high confidencesource
  • 🆕Faculty AI professional development sessions (2025-2026). Moorpark College's Professional Development calendar lists AI sessions including 'AI and Education Basics' and 'AI and Education Applications' (Aug 6, 2025), 'AI in the Classroom Workshop' (Oct 8, 2025), 'AI and Academic Honesty' and 'NotebookLM' (Jan 10, 2025), and 'Open Dialogue: AI in Education' (Feb 3, 2026). 2026 · high confidencesource
  • 🆕Moorpark instructional technologist spoke at regional AI Summit. Trudi Radtke, instructional technologist at Moorpark College, was a featured speaker at Allan Hancock College's inaugural AI Summit (April 18, 2025), addressing AI ethics and transparency ('biased input will equal biased output') alongside experts from the CCC Chancellor's Office, LinkedIn, Cal Poly, and Berkeley. 2025 · medium confidencesource
  • State-level AI guidance curated for administrators. The AI Toolkit's State Guidance page compiles California Community Colleges Chancellor's Office AI resources, including the Digital Center for Innovation, Transformation and Equity, the HUMANS-centered approach, the Vision 2030 roadmap, and the July 2024 Board report on AI in enrollment management and personalized learning. 2026 · medium confidencesource
AI Policies · 2
  • Academic dishonesty policy explicitly covers AI. Moorpark College's academic dishonesty policy lists 'Using artificial intelligence (AI) to generate content and presenting it as your own' under Cheating, and under Fabrication includes 'the use of false information provided by artificial intelligence (AI) generators.' undated · high confidencesource
  • AI syllabus statement guidance for faculty. The AI Toolkit's Syllabus/Classroom page provides faculty AI syllabus statement examples ranging from most restrictive to maximally permissive, an 'AI Policy Script' for the first day of class, a cheating-clarity chart, and links to the ASCCC 'Academic Integrity Policies in an AI World' resource. 2026 · high confidencesource
AI Courses, Tools & Resources · 3
  • Library AI Toolkit LibGuide (3+ years of AI research). The Moorpark College Library maintains a comprehensive 'AI Toolkit' LibGuide created by instructional technologist Trudi Radtke and librarian Danielle Kaprelian, representing over three years of AI research including a case study on students and AI; it covers intro to AI, AI tools, syllabus/classroom, state guidance, and administrators. Last updated June 11, 2026. 2026 · high confidencesource
  • Curated AI research tools for students. The AI Toolkit recommends and explains AI research and prompting tools for students, including Perplexity, Scite AI, ResearchRabbit, and Chatbot Arena, plus a CLEAR prompt-engineering framework (Concise, Logical, Explicit, Adaptive, Reflective) and intro to prompting with Claude. 2026 · high confidencesource
  • Data Science certificate with machine learning/AI. Moorpark College offers a Certificate of Achievement in Data Science (15-16 units) whose courses study 'machine learning which is a type of artificial intelligence (AI),' including CS M10DS Introduction to Data Science and CS M10ML Cloud Data Science and Machine Learning (covers AWS SageMaker, Amazon Rekognition computer vision, and NLP tools). undated · high confidencesource
